**Job Description**:
AP Invoicing Lead - Primary responsibilities involve managing the timely and accurate processing of invoices, ensuring compliance with company policies and procedures, and supervising a team of AP Analyst. The AP Invoicing Lead typically handles complex invoices, resolves discrepancies, and collaborates with other departments or vendors to address issues related to invoicing. They might also implement process improvements to enhance efficiency and accuracy in invoice processing while ensuring adherence to regulatory requirements.
**Key Job Responsibilities**
- Oversee the end-to-end invoice processing cycle, ensuring accuracy, completeness, and adherence to company policies and regulatory requirements.
- Recruit and Coordinate onboarding activities for new hires, ensuring they receive necessary training and information to integrate smoothly into the AP team.
- Lead and manage a team of AP Invoicing Analyst, including task assignment, performance evaluation,
- training, and fostering a positive work environment.
- Identify opportunities to streamline and optimize the invoicing process, implementing best practices to improve efficiency and reduce errors.
- Collaborate with internal and external auditors, providing necessary documentation and support during audits to ensure compliance and accuracy of financial records.
- Investigate and resolve discrepancies in invoices, collaborating with internal stakeholders, vendors, or suppliers to address and rectify issues promptly.
